Rep. Angie Craig Announces Candidacy for WNBA Commissioner Role

Rep. Angie Craig Announces Candidacy for WNBA Commissioner Role

U.S. Representative Angie Craig (D-Minn.) has officially expressed interest in succeeding Cathy Engelbert as commissioner of the Women’s National Basketball Association (WNBA). The announcement comes shortly after Engelbert revealed plans to retire, a departure that coincides with a period of significant growth and heightened public scrutiny for the league.

On Friday, Craig took to the social media platform X to declare her availability, writing, “Hey, @WNBA, I’m a free agent in January.” The former congressional candidate is looking to leverage her political experience in the professional sports leadership space.

Craig is no stranger to competitive elections, having previously lost the Democratic primary for Lieutenant Governor of Minnesota to Peggy Flanagan. Her move to join the WNBA search represents a notable pivot from electoral politics to sports administration as the league navigates its current landscape.
